Pa.'s highest paid employees: Prison guards are among them

Thirty-eight hours of overtime a week: That's how much the 10 top-earning corrections officers worked on average, according to 2015-16 data from a Legislative Budget and Finance Committee report published in January. How much do prison guards make?

As the table shows, half of all prison guards earned between $41,690 and $63,150. The median salary of $49,850 means half earned more than this and half earned less. There can be significant variation in average pay by state based on factors like cost of living, level of government funding, and demand for workers. ...

How much does a prison guard make in Illinois?

Prisons guards work in a range of facility types including: Federal prisons tend to offer the highest average salary at $61,600 per year. State prisons offer around $51,300 on average. The lowest paying facilities are local jails, with county jails averaging around $45,400 and municipal jails at $42,500. See also How Many Prisons Are In Illinois? ...

How much Hazard Pay does a prison guard get?

Given the risks and dangers of the job, many facilities provide an additional hazard pay differential for prison guards. This can be a set dollar amount or a percentage bonus above the base salary. In high risk maximum security facilities, hazard pay can exceed $2,000 per year. ...
